Welcome to Atrium Hotel, your Split “home away from home.” Atrium Hotel aims to make your visit as relaxing and enjoyable as possible, which is why so many guests continue to come back year after year.
Given the close proximity of popular landmarks, such as Poljud Stadium (0.8 mi) and Grgur Ninski Statue (0.8 mi), guests of Atrium Hotel can easily experience some of Split's most well known attractions.
Rooms at Atrium Hotel provide a flat screen TV, air conditioning, and a minibar, and guests can stay connected with free wifi.
In addition, while staying at Atrium Hotel guests have access to room service and a concierge. You can also enjoy a pool and free breakfast.
Travellers looking to enjoy some tapas can head to Uje oil bar, Wine & Cheese Bar Paradox, or Diocletian's Wine House. Otherwise, you may want to check out a steakhouse such as CHOPS GRILL Steak & Seafood, Bakra - Steak & Pizza Bar, or Toro grill bar.
If you’re looking for things to do, you can check out Diocletian's Palace (0.8 mi), Cathedral and Bell Tower of St. Domnius (0.8 mi), or Old Split (0.8 mi), which are popular attractions amongst tourists, and they are all within walking distance.

Nice hotel, 18-20 min walk from old town. Rooms are well equipped with teapot, but internet was very weak on the room. Very good breakfast. Nice small gym with sauna, which is free off charge. Also, there is shopping mall right behind hotel. We enjoyed our stay, but it wold be nice, if we could stay closer to old town.
Hotel near Joker shopping center in Split. The room was spacious with all bath amenities, 36m2. Breakfast and pool where OK, food at breakfast was fresh. Went to our new hotel, Hotel Atrium. We were originally given a room on the 5th floor, but it had a high sided tub/shower so my spouse went to the front desk and asked for another room. Our new room was handicap accessible and the shower walls only came to waist high. Our bedroom was large with a table and two chairs in addition to a nice desk, floor lamp and two electrical outlets. The bedding was nice and the pillows fluffy. Only one luggage rack so I had to put my bag on the round table. There was a refrigerator and in-room safe. Room came with an electric pot for coffee or tea water. As mentioned, the bathroom was handicap accessible and we were provided with containers of body soap, shampoo and body lotion.
If this hotel was slightly nearer the old town, it World get 5. Friendly staff, big rooms, indoor pool, fitness centre, great buffet breakfast. This is 1 from the old town, but the walk is easy enough (except for the summer heat).

Lovely hotel with large rooms. About 20mins walking into centre of Split. At back of hotel Joker mall if forgotten anything. Nice meals stayed two nights and vegetarian option was very good indeed. Friendly staff especially the bar and waiting staff. Tea and coffee making in room.
We stayed here as part of a tour group. We were pleasantly surprised by the huge room & bathroom. The shower had good water pressure. AC was a plus. It’s a 10-15 min straight shot walk to old town which was fine for us. One of the better big hotel breakfasts with a good variety of well executed options.
